Matheran, an esteemed hill station located near Mumbai, has closed its gates to visitors as local residents and business owners, united under the Matheran Paryatan Vachav Sangharsh Samiti (MPVSS), initiated an indefinite protest. This movement stems from an increase in scams affecting tourists, with the community advocating for enhanced regulations to combat these issues. Situated high above the busy city of Mumbai, Matheran is a peaceful retreat cherished by both nature enthusiasts and thrill-seekers. At an elevation of 2,636 feet, this delightful hill station is celebrated for its calming atmosphere and pristine landscapes.

Explore the Alluring Viewpoints of Matheran:

Echo Point: Living up to its name, Echo Point offers a memorable auditory experience as sounds bounce off the verdant hillsides. The stunning backdrop enhances the charm, making it an essential stop for visitors.

Porcupine Point: Resembling its namesake, Porcupine Point showcases breathtaking sunsets that illuminate the sky in brilliant colors. The wide-ranging views include Prabal Fort and the impressive Cathedral Rocks.

Panorama Point: Experience the picturesque Sahyadri Ranges from Panorama Point. This favored location boasts expansive views of the surrounding scenery, offering a tranquil getaway.

Louisa Point: Elevated at 800 meters, Louisa Point provides dramatic views of the valleys below, which are filled with lush greenery. The iconic Prabal Fort stands proudly in the background, enhancing the visual splendor.

One Tree Hill Point: Aptly named, One Tree Hill Point features a solitary tree that marks this distinctive landmark. The sweeping vistas of the valleys and mountains render it a dream location for photographers.

Belvedere Point: Experience peace at Belvedere Point, where expansive views of the Western Ghats and flourishing valleys greet you. The calm environment makes it a perfect venue for quiet reflection.

Mount Barry: Take a hike to Mount Barry and be rewarded with sweeping panoramas of Matheran’s natural beauty. The verdant forests and valleys of the Western Ghats unfold before you, creating an unforgettable experience.

Alexander Point: Admire Matheran's splendor from Alexander Point, another scenic location offering magnificent panoramic views. The lush scenery and majesty of the Western Ghats form a captivating display.

Malang Point: Retreat to the calm of Malang Point, where you can immerse yourself in the peacefulness of Matheran’s nature. The wide-reaching views of the valleys, forests, and Western Ghats evoke a sense of tranquility and awe.

Charlotte Lake: Enveloped by thick woods, Charlotte Lake is Matheran's main water source. The tranquil setting, coupled with the nearby Pisarnath Temple, adds both natural and spiritual importance to this area.

Monkey Point: True to its name, Monkey Point is a sanctuary for lively monkeys. The natural allure of the landscape, featuring mountains, ravines, and a diverse array of plant and animal life, makes it a favorite destination among tourists.

Adventure Awaits in Matheran:

Rock Climbing: Matheran serves as a haven for those passionate about rock climbing, featuring exhilarating locations such as Shivaji’s Ladder, Alexander Point, Prabal Fort, and Louisa Point that present exciting challenges.

Dodhani Waterfalls: Immerse yourself in the excitement of waterfall rappelling at Dodhani Waterfalls, nestled at the foot of the Matheran Hills. This thrilling activity caters to both novices and seasoned adventure enthusiasts alike.

Journey Through Time:

Prabhal Fort: Discover the historical significance of Prabhal Fort, an ancient fortress located close to Matheran. At an elevation of 800 meters, this site provides a glimpse into the area's rich heritage, combined with stunning panoramic scenery.

Neral-Matheran Toy Train: Enjoy a charming trip on the Neral-Matheran Toy Train, a narrow-gauge railway that winds through the breathtaking vistas of the Western Ghats. This delightful ride showcases magnificent views of valleys, lush forests, and cascading waterfalls.

How to Reach Matheran:

By Air: The closest airports to Matheran are in Mumbai (90 km away) and Pune (120 km away). From Mumbai Airport, you can access Neral through buses, taxis, and local trains, the entry point to Matheran.

By Rail: Commuter trains from Mumbai (CSMT/Thane) along with outstation services such as the Deccan Express and Sahyadri Express make stops at Neral. From there, toy trains or taxis are available to take you to Dasturi Naka.

By Road: Matheran is easily reachable by road. The drive from Mumbai takes around 1.5 to 2 hours via the Mumbai-Pune Expressway, while traveling from Pune will take approximately 2.5 to 3 hours along the same route. Buses from destinations including Mumbai, Pune, Nasik, and Kolhapur frequently operate on this corridor.
